Why is my Samsung charging so slowly?
There may be the following reasons for the slow charging of Android phones or Android not charging: The charger or data cable is not plugged in properly. Slow charging because the charging port is not clean. High ambient temperature and slow charging when the phone is hot.
Why is my phone not fast charging anymore?
Make sure the fast charging feature is enabled. Navigate to Settings, tap Battery, select Charging, and enable fast charging if it’s disabled. If the option is already enabled, toggle it off, and restart your terminal. Wait for 30 seconds, turn on your device, enable fast charging again, and check the results.
Why is my phone charging slow?
The most straightforward reason your phone might be charging slower than before might have nothing to do with the phone itself. Instead, you could have a bad cord or adaptor, or weak power source. USB cables get put through a lot, especially in homes with multiple users and devices.
How do I make my Samsung Charge faster?
Tap Battery, and then tap More battery settings. Tap the switch next to Fast charging, Super fast charging, or Fast wireless charging. To start Fast charging or Super fast charging, connect the USB cable to the phone, and then plug the USB power adapter into a power outlet.

How to troubleshoot Samsung Galaxy Note 20 Superfast charging issue?
Before troubleshooting Note 20, check that the Superfast charging feature is already turned on, in your phone to avoid misunderstanding. By default, it should be enabled; however, anything can happen since it is an electronic device. Go to the Settings app on your phone. Tap Device care > Battery > Charging.

How do I know if my Galaxy device supports fast charging?
Fast charging of your Galaxy device may vary depending on device model and condition of the adapter or cable. To check if your device supports fast charging, check the enclosed manual or relevant product information on samsung.com when purchasing the product. The name of the menu may vary depending on the device model and software version.
